Ametropia
Conditions
Brief summary
Dispensing Study for the Phenacite Project. The investigational test lens was not the final optical design and the study was not used for design validation.
Detailed description
Evaluate the objective and patient-reported visual acceptability of the Phenacite contact lens.
Interventions
Subjects will be randomized to wear the Phenacite contact lenses binocularly.
Subjects will be randomized to wear the comfilcon A contact lenses binocularly.

Eligibility
Inclusion criteria
* Oculo-visual examination in the last two years * Between 18 and 35 years of age and has full legal capacity to volunteer * Has read and understood the informed consent letter * Is willing and able to follow instructions and maintain the appointment schedule * Is correctable to a visual acuity of 20/25 or better (in each eye) with their habitual correction or 20/20 best corrected * Currently wears, or has previously successfully worn, soft contact lenses between -1.00D and -4.00D * Spherical Contact Lens Rx between -1.00 and -4.00 and spectacle cylinder ≤-0.75 * Has not worn lenses for at least 12 hours before the initial visit * Has a subjective response at baseline, which indicates suitability for this study * Currently spends a minimum of 4 hours a day; 5 days a week on digital devices and can replicate this time during the study period * Is willing and able to wear the study contact lenses a minimum of 10 hours per day; 5 days a week.
Exclusion criteria
* Has never worn contact lenses before * Any systemic disease affecting ocular health * Is using any systemic or topical medications that will affect ocular health * Has known sensitivity to the diagnostic pharmaceuticals or study products used in this study. * Has any ocular pathology or anomaly that would affect the wearing of the lenses * Has persistent, clinically significant corneal or conjunctival staining using sodium fluorescein dye * Is aphakic * Has anisometropia of \>1.00 * Has undergone corneal refractive surgery * Has strabismus * Has any ocular amblyopia \>= 1line of HC Visual Acuity * Is participating in any other type of eye related clinical or research study * Has participated in study CV-14-32.
Design outcomes
Primary
| Measure | Time frame | Description |
|---|---|---|
| Subjective Ratings of Lens Comfort | Baseline (after 15 minutes of lens dispense) | Subjective ratings of lens comfort. Comfort Scale (0,100; 0=extremely uncomfortable/cannot tolerate; 100 = extremely comfortable/cannot be felt) |
| Over Refraction for Optimized Distance Acuity | 2 weeks | Over Refraction for optimized distance acuity measured using logMAR |
| Binocular Distance Visual Acuity - High Illumination High Contrast | Baseline (after 5 minutes of lens dispense) | Binocular Distance Visual Acuity - High Illumination High Contrast was measured using logMAR |
| Binocular Distance Visual Acuity - Low Illumination High Contrast | Baseline (after 5 minutes of lens dispense) | Binocular Distance Visual Acuity - Low Illumination High Contrast was measured using logMAR |
| Binocular Near Visual Acuity - High Illumination High Contrast | Baseline (after 5 minutes of lens dispense) | Binocular Near Visual Acuity - High Illumination High Contrast was measured using logMAR |
| Binocular Near Visual Acuity - Low Illumination High Contrast | Baseline (after 5 minutes of lens dispense) | Binocular Near Visual Acuity - Low Illumination High Contrast was measured using logMAR |

Outcome results
Binocular Distance Visual Acuity - High Illumination High Contrast
Binocular Distance Visual Acuity - High Illumination High Contrast was measured using logMAR
Time frame: Baseline (after 5 minutes of lens dispense)
Population: One subject was excluded from the analysis.
| Arm | Measure | Value (MEAN) | Dispersion |
|---|---|---|---|
| Phenacite | Binocular Distance Visual Acuity - High Illumination High Contrast | -0.18 logMAR | Standard Deviation 0.06 |
| Comfilcon A | Binocular Distance Visual Acuity - High Illumination High Contrast | -0.21 logMAR | Standard Deviation 0.06 |
Binocular Distance Visual Acuity - High Illumination High Contrast
Binocular Distance Visual Acuity - High Illumination High Contrast was measured using logMAR
Time frame: 2 weeks
| Arm | Measure | Value (MEAN) | Dispersion |
|---|---|---|---|
| Phenacite | Binocular Distance Visual Acuity - High Illumination High Contrast | -0.19 logMAR | Standard Deviation 0.07 |
| Comfilcon A | Binocular Distance Visual Acuity - High Illumination High Contrast | -0.20 logMAR | Standard Deviation 0.05 |

Subjective Ratings of Lens Comfort
Subjective ratings of lens comfort. Comfort Scale (0,100; 0=extremely uncomfortable/cannot tolerate; 100 = extremely comfortable/cannot be felt)
Time frame: Baseline (after 15 minutes of lens dispense)
Population: One subject was excluded from the analysis.
| Arm | Measure | Value (MEAN) | Dispersion |
|---|---|---|---|
| Phenacite | Subjective Ratings of Lens Comfort | 86.50 units on a scale | Standard Deviation 14.99 |
| Comfilcon A | Subjective Ratings of Lens Comfort | 90.13 units on a scale | Standard Deviation 8.6 |
Subjective Ratings of Lens Comfort
Subjective ratings of lens comfort. Comfort Scale (0,100; 0=extremely uncomfortable/cannot tolerate; 100 = extremely comfortable/cannot be felt)
Time frame: 2 Weeks
| Arm | Measure | Value (MEAN) | Dispersion |
|---|---|---|---|
| Phenacite | Subjective Ratings of Lens Comfort | 66.46 units on a scale | Standard Deviation 25.22 |
| Comfilcon A | Subjective Ratings of Lens Comfort | 71.71 units on a scale | Standard Deviation 24.62 |
Conjunctival Staining
Conjunctival staining was assessed on a scale of 0-4, 0.50 steps (0-None, 1 - Minimal diffuse punctuate, 2- Coalescent Punctuate, 3- confluent, 4- Deep confluent
Time frame: 2 weeks
| Arm | Measure | Group | Value (MEAN) | Dispersion |
|---|---|---|---|---|
| Phenacite | Conjunctival Staining | Nasal | 0.48 units on a scale | Standard Deviation 0.46 |
| Phenacite | Conjunctival Staining | Inferior | 0.02 units on a scale | Standard Deviation 0.1 |
| Phenacite | Conjunctival Staining | Temporal | 0.11 units on a scale | Standard Deviation 0.36 |
| Phenacite | Conjunctival Staining | Superior | 0.00 units on a scale | Standard Deviation 0 |
| Comfilcon A | Conjunctival Staining | Superior | 0.05 units on a scale | Standard Deviation 0.26 |
| Comfilcon A | Conjunctival Staining | Temporal | 0.18 units on a scale | Standard Deviation 0.43 |
| Comfilcon A | Conjunctival Staining | Inferior | 0.10 units on a scale | Standard Deviation 0.27 |
| Comfilcon A | Conjunctival Staining | Nasal | 0.38 units on a scale | Standard Deviation 0.57 |
Corneal Staining Extent
Corneal staining extent was assessed on a scale of 0-4 (0-No Staining, 1 - 1-15% of area, 2- 16-30% of area, 3- 31-45% of area, 4- \>45% of area
Time frame: 2 weeks
| Arm | Measure | Group | Value (MEAN) | Dispersion |
|---|---|---|---|---|
| Phenacite | Corneal Staining Extent | Central | 0.02 units on a scale | Standard Deviation 0.14 |
| Phenacite | Corneal Staining Extent | Temporal | 0.00 units on a scale | Standard Deviation 0 |
| Phenacite | Corneal Staining Extent | Nasal | 0.00 units on a scale | Standard Deviation 0 |
| Phenacite | Corneal Staining Extent | Superior | 0.00 units on a scale | Standard Deviation 0 |
| Phenacite | Corneal Staining Extent | Inferior | 0.21 units on a scale | Standard Deviation 0.5 |
| Comfilcon A | Corneal Staining Extent | Superior | 0.04 units on a scale | Standard Deviation 0.2 |
| Comfilcon A | Corneal Staining Extent | Inferior | 0.42 units on a scale | Standard Deviation 0.58 |
| Comfilcon A | Corneal Staining Extent | Central | 0.00 units on a scale | Standard Deviation 0 |
| Comfilcon A | Corneal Staining Extent | Nasal | 0.00 units on a scale | Standard Deviation 0 |
| Comfilcon A | Corneal Staining Extent | Temporal | 0.00 units on a scale | Standard Deviation 0 |
